Experience the ultimate test of endurance and strength at the COREX Fitness Challenge—a multi-station workout event designed for athletes of all levels. Set to take place on Saturday, July 18, 2026, from 7:00 AM to noon in the scenic outdoor parking lot of CORE Cycle.Fitness.Lagree, located at 229 Waterman Street in Providence, Rhode Island. This event offers two distinct divisions for participants. For those seeking a competitive edge and aiming to push personal limits, the Competitor Division is perfect. Athletes will compete under official judging standards, with awards presented to top finishers: - 1st Place Male & Female - 2nd Place Male & Female - 3rd Place Male & Female Each participant will navigate through six challenging workout stations before finishing with a run that tests strength, endurance, and pacing. This division is ideal for serious athletes, coaches, trainers, and fitness enthusiasts looking to compete. For those who prefer the full COREX experience without the pressure of formal competition, the Open Division provides an accessible path to participation. Participants will receive official timing results but can complete the course at their own pace in a supportive environment where judges offer guidance as needed. The goal is simple: finish and celebrate your accomplishment. Every participant crossing the finish line receives an exclusive COREX Finisher Medal and event shirt, marking both personal achievement and community spirit. To ensure smooth operations, participants are encouraged to select their division first and then choose from start waves at 7:00 AM or every 15 minutes thereafter until 10:45 AM. Each wave is limited to five athletes on a first-come, first-served basis. Providence is the state capital and largest city in Rhode Island, as well as the third largest city in New England. It used to be a heavily industrialized bastion of organized crime, but Providence's recent renaissance has created new parks and attractions and brought emphasis back to its historic roots as an intellectual center. Downcity events, historic vistas, eclectic districts such as College Hill and Federal Hill, and a great nightlife make Providence a worthwhile tourist destination. Today, it is perhaps best known as the home of Brown University.
